About This Item

New York: G. P. Putnam's Sons, 2007. Fine in fine dust jacket.. Signed first printing of this 20th novel in the Alphabet Mystery series, alternating between the point of view of Kinsey Millhone - on the case of potential insurance fraud and a con-artist - and said con-artist, a sociopath known for taking advantage of the elderly. The success of the Kinsey Millhone books inspired a generation of writers to create their own casually badass heroines, to the delight of millions of readers. 9'' x 5.75''. Original boards. Original unclipped ($26.95) color pictorial dust jacket. 388 pages. Signed by Grafton to title page. Jacket with a hint of edgewear. Sharp.

About Type Punch Matrix

Type Punch Matrix is a rare book firm founded by Rebecca Romney and Brian Cassidy. TPM is a member firm of the Antiquarian Booksellers Association of America and upholds their Code of Ethics.
